I was researching what it takes to become a resident of Japan and this is what it said: "Foreign residents who have shown good conduct and have sufficient assets or ability to make an independent living, can be granted permanent residence if they reside in Japan for typically ten or more consecutive years (less in case of spouses of Japanese nationals and people who have made significant contributions to Japanese society). Permanent residence status is indefinite and allows any paid activity."
I'll be like... 35 or something before I'll be considered a permanent resident, and it takes 5 more years after that unless I get married to a citizen for me to be considered a citizen o__o"

Tyler came over today and helped me set up Rosetta Stone (illegally I may add :P) and it is amazing.

 If you don't know what Rosetta Stone is, it's a program that teaches languages through association with images, intuition, context, ect. There is no English involved in the learning so it's much like how you learned to speak your native language when you were but a baby!
I only just started and so I don't know much but I do know "Onnanokotachi wa mizu nonde imasen" Which means "The girl and her friends are not drinking water." I can say the same thing for the adults and males and can substitute water for a few other things like coffee and rice and such, but I may or may not forget in the morning, it needs to be repeated a few times for me to get it. xD
